There is one joker: Highly skilled technicians. Our two techs are why we can do projects that are ambitious, clear first author, no 100h weeks. Requires very strong commitment to a few projects by PI (more applicable to wetlab, and a + of πͺπΈ is that there's no industry competing for the best people).
IMHO Itβs near impossible to sustainably scale an academic research team quickly to 5-10 people. My take: Keep the bar for hiring high, keep money in the bank (allows you to scale up when things start working), and keep two full days per week free of Interruptions for hands on work.

Beeswarm plot of the prediction error across different methods of double perturbations showing that all methods (scGPT, scFoundation, UCE, scBERT, Geneformer, GEARS, and CPA) perform worse than the additive baseline.
Line plot of the true positive rate against the false discovery proportion showing that none of the methods is better at finding non additive interactions than simply predicting no change.
Our paper benchmarking foundation models for perturbation effect prediction is finally published ππ₯³π
www.nature.com/articles/s41...
We show that none of the available* models outperform simple linear baselines. Since the original preprint, we added more methods, metrics, and prettier figures!
